Truly, it is We who have revealed to you the Quran, a gradual revelation. 23 So wait patiently for the command of your Lord and do not yield to any sinful or disbelieving person among them (people). 24 And remember the name of your Lord morning and evening. 25 Prostrate before Him and glorify Him extensively during the night. 26 Indeed, these love the hasty life, and are heedless and leave behind them a heavy Day. 27 It is We Who created them, and We have made them of strong built. And when We will, We can replace them with others like them with a complete replacement. 28 This is indeed an advice; so whoever wishes may take the path towards his Lord. 29 And you do not please except that Allah please, surely Allah is Knowing, Wise; 30 For He admits into His mercy whomsoever He will; as for the evildoers, He has prepared for them a painful chastisement. 31
Almighty Allah's Truth.
End of Surah: The Human (Al-Insan). Sent down in Medina after The All Compassionate (Al-Rahman) before Divorce (Al-Talaaq)
